Because rating data has not yet accumulated, you'll want to verify credentials and ask about experience when contacting practices directly. The Colorado Board of Chiropractic Examiners maintains licensure records, which you can cross-reference to ensure any practitioner you're considering meets state standards. Starting your search by calling ahead to ask about their approach, patient volume, and scheduling availability will help you find a good fit for your needs.
When evaluating a chiropractor, confirm their license is current and in good standing with the state board. Trustworthy practitioners will provide transparent information about their credentials, explain their treatment approach upfront, and discuss costs before beginning care. Be cautious of anyone who pressures you into long-term payment plans immediately or refuses to provide written documentation of your treatment plan. Avoid practices that operate cash-only with no receipt system or claim they can cure conditions beyond the scope of chiropractic care.
